I'm on BC's. Not sure what people are talking about. My tires are tucked and I'm no where near maxed out. In fact, if I went lower I'd tear my car up driving around Atlanta...



BC's have a 30 point dampening system. I'm on 22 F/R (1=hard 30=soft). They are 8 stock, and the bumps are terrible. If you live somewhere with good roads, you're fine. If not, you have to go way soft.
